What to Consider?
The best pool vacuum that meets your needs will be determined by your pool, the filters you’re using, the amount of manual labor you can put into maintenance, and what you’re willing to pay.
1. Power
Many pool vacuums depend on the pump in your pool and/or filter to suction. However, some models run on batteries or come with built-in filters that make vacuuming easier but are generally the most expensive option. Before choosing the right pool vacuum, be sure it’s compatible with your setup.
2. The Type of Debris
Other considerable aspects when shopping for an appropriate pool vacuum is the debris you’re cleaning and whether or not it’s possible to connect it to the pump in your pool and/or the filtration system. Certain vacuums are better suited to big debris, like leaves, while others can capture small pieces of dirt.
3. Manual Vs. Automatic
If you’ve got a small pool, you may prefer to push the manual vacuum around once or twice a week. However, those who prefer a hands-free cleaning might prefer a robotic or automatic vacuum.
Be aware that the larger the number of moving components that a pool vacuum features to work with, the more maintenance it’ll require and the higher the chance of it falling apart.
4. Pressure Vs. Suction
Pool vacuums are also classified as “pressure-side” or “suction-side.” The pressure cleaners were made for use with one side, which is the “pressure” side, of your pump.
They usually collect debris in a bag that is floating over the vacuum. Suction cleaners are attached to your pool’s skimmer or an appropriate cleaner line and function than the vacuum.

Things to Think About Before Buying the Best Pool Cleaner for Leaves
1. The Type and Size of the Pool
Regarding the types of pools and sizes, Pool vacuum cleaners are suitable for above-ground pools or in-ground pools.
The distinction between an aboveground and an in-ground pool is smaller, measuring around 30 feet in length, and is ideal for pool cleaners with between 30-40 feet coverage.
The inground pool that is bigger, reaching a maximum of 60 feet, needs pool vacuum cleaners that can give greater coverage of 40 and 60 feet.
Remember that saltwater pools come in various types that require pool cleaning equipment specifically designed to resist saltwater effects and remove dirt associated with saltwater pools.
2. Types of Pool Cleaners
Pool cleaners fall into three categories: manual, automatic, and robotic pool cleaners.
You can clean the manual pool cleaner by hand, while the automated pool cleaners come in two kinds of suction side cleaners. The other is the pressure side cleaner is a computerized cleaning procedure.
It is important to note that the pressure side cleaner for pools is better for leaves because it’s specifically designing for larger particle sizes. Likewise, these suction cleaners are suitable for smaller particles.
The robotic pool cleaners are automated, but they are more sophisticated in their functionality since they typically operate with the help of remote controls and can reduce personal interference in contrast to regular pool cleaners.
3. Size and Type of Debris
Each pool vacuum is designed to help keep the pool spotless by removing dirt and debris. But, before doing that, you need to consider the type of debris and size your pool cleaner faces.
An effective pool leaf vacuum not only clears the pool of leaf debris but as well other kinds of debris. Although the leaf is a large piece of debris, there are also small and fine particles such as pollen, dust, sand, and more.
Larger amounts of debris will require a greater suction capacity cleaner. Conversely, smaller particles require less.
